Median Home Price in Winchester, VA

The median home value in Winchester, VA is $403,554 as of 2026-07-31, up 1.44% from a year earlier.

Winchester ranks #22 of 62 Virginia cities tracked here by median home value, and sits 21.8% above the state's city median of $331,461. It sits in Frederick County, where the county-wide median is $432,111.

Housing affordability in Winchester

Median household income in Winchester is $63,974, so the typical home value is about 6.3× annual household income. This is a simple price-to-income benchmark rather than a monthly payment estimate; it does not account for mortgage rates, down payments, taxes or insurance.

Household income comes from the U.S. Census Bureau's ACS 5-Year Estimates, table B19013 (how the affordability measure works).

Crime in Winchester

Winchester police recorded a violent crime rate of 238 per 100,000 residents in 2024 — around the middle of the range for reporting cities. Property crime runs at 2,328 per 100,000.
